Physical activity predicts changes in body image during obesity treatment in women.

机构信息

Faculty of Human Kinetics, Technical University of Lisbon, Lisbon, Portugal.

出版信息

Med Sci Sports Exerc. 2012 Aug;44(8):1604-12. doi: 10.1249/MSS.0b013e31824d922a.

Abstract

PURPOSE

This study examined effects of a behavioral weight management intervention on body image (evaluative and investment dimensions) and explored the potential mediating role of structured and lifestyle physical activity (PA).

METHODS

The study was a longitudinal randomized controlled trial, including a 1-yr behavior change intervention and a 2-yr follow-up (225 women, 37.6 ± 7 yr, body mass index = 31.5 ± 4.1 kg·m). Statistical analyses comprised mixed-design ANOVAs with repeated measures, bivariate/partial correlations, and mediation analyses.

RESULTS

Body image improved considerably in both groups, favoring the intervention group (small to moderate effect sizes: 0.03-0.05), but began to deteriorate from 12 to 24 months, especially in the intervention group. Consequently, at 24 months, between-group differences were small and did not reach significance. Yet, levels of body dissatisfaction and dysfunctional investment remained below initial values (for both groups). Results were similar for both body image dimensions. Structured PA (at 12 and 24 months) and lifestyle PA (at 24 months) were positively associated with (r > -0.25, P < 0.05) and partially mediated body image improvements, especially in the investment component (95% confidence interval of -1.88 to -0.27 for structured PA at 12 months, 95% confidence interval of -1.94 to -0.21 for lifestyle PA at 24 months). In general, change in evaluative body image was not mediated by exercise participation, seeming more dependent on weight change.

CONCLUSIONS

These findings highlight the importance of PA as a contributing factor in the improvement of body image in overweight/obese women, mainly by reducing excessive salience of appearance to one's life and self. Lifestyle PA may also be a valid option, particularly in the long term. Exercise might provide a buffer against body image deterioration overtime, favoring lasting weight loss maintenance.

摘要

目的

本研究旨在考察行为体重管理干预对身体意象(评价和投资维度)的影响,并探讨结构化和生活方式体力活动(PA)的潜在中介作用。

方法

该研究是一项纵向随机对照试验,包括为期 1 年的行为改变干预和为期 2 年的随访(225 名女性,37.6±7 岁,体重指数=31.5±4.1kg·m)。统计分析包括混合设计重复测量方差分析、双变量/偏相关分析和中介分析。

结果

两组的身体意象均有显著改善,干预组效果更为显著(小到中等效应大小:0.03-0.05),但从 12 个月到 24 个月开始恶化,尤其是干预组。因此,在 24 个月时,两组间的差异较小,没有达到显著性。然而,身体不满和功能失调投资的水平仍低于初始值(两组均如此)。两种身体意象维度的结果相似。结构化 PA(在 12 个月和 24 个月)和生活方式 PA(在 24 个月)与身体意象的改善呈正相关(r>−0.25,P<0.05),并部分介导了身体意象的改善,尤其是在投资成分方面(12 个月时结构化 PA 的 95%置信区间为-1.88 至-0.27,24 个月时生活方式 PA 的 95%置信区间为-1.94 至-0.21)。总体而言,评价身体意象的变化不受运动参与的影响,似乎更多地取决于体重的变化。

结论

这些发现强调了 PA 作为超重/肥胖女性改善身体意象的一个重要因素的重要性,主要是通过减少外表对生活和自我的过度关注。生活方式 PA 也可能是一个有效的选择,特别是在长期。锻炼可能有助于防止身体意象随时间恶化,有利于持久的体重维持。
